GE Fanuc DS200RTBAG3AFB Mark V Relay Terminal Board is manufactured and designed by General Electric, belonging to the Mark V series, and is used in turbine control systems.
Hardware Specifications
Relays: The board is equipped with 10 relays positioned at K20-K29.
K20-K26: 7 DPDT (Double Pole Double Throw) relays, each with two C-type contacts and a contact rating of 10A.
K27-K29: 3 4PDT (Four Pole Double Throw) relays, each with four C-type contacts and a rating of 1A per contact.
These relays are protected by a 130VAC Metal Oxide Varistor (MOV). Some relay coils operate at 115V AC: K20-K26 use 115V AC coils with 10A DPDT contacts, while K27-K29 use 115V AC coils with 1A 4PDT contacts.
Jumpers: Berg-type hardware jumpers are adopted. The circuit board can be configured via jumpers to adapt to different applications, allowing the selection of external or internal power supply for each relay.
Connectors: The board's terminals have slots for up to 52 connectors, each fixed by individual screws. Compatible connectors include CPH and CPN plug connectors, Y9-Y35 connectors, K20-K26 connectors, 115V connectors, RX1-RX7 connectors, X2 connectors, etc.
PCB Coating: It is a printed circuit board with a general coating. The "G3" in the part number indicates a 3-group style PCB. Although it has a thick layer of protection, it is generally less comprehensively protected than a conformal-coated circuit board.
Functional Applications
It is part of the protection core and main trip circuit, featuring three sets of three emergency trip relays and at least two sets of main trip relays (PTR1 and 2). It also has four auxiliary control outputs for electrical lock solenoid valves, oil reset solenoid valves, mechanical lock solenoid valves, and oil test solenoid valves. It can perform various tests, such as actual electrical overspeed trip tests, mechanical trip piston tests, actual mechanical overspeed trip tests, TMR cross-trip tests, etc.
Installation Precautions
When installing, first remove the screws and washers fixing the board in the drive. During removal, prevent metal hardware from falling into the drive to avoid safety hazards or equipment damage.
Pay attention to various plastic brackets and clips during installation. For example, CP1PL-CP5PL and Y9PL-Y37PL connectors are fixed in place by built-in fixing clips. To release these connectors, press the connector lever; for cables with pull tabs, pull the tabs gently when releasing.
The GE Fanuc DS200RTBAG3AFB Mark V relay terminal board, as a key component of the steam turbine control system, is mainly applied to steam turbines in thermal power plants and nuclear power plants, as well as gas turbines in petroleum refining, natural gas transportation and other fields. It is responsible for safety functions such as emergency tripping control and overspeed protection, and can interact with sensors such as pressure and temperature sensors to achieve interlock protection for key equipment. It supports a triple modular redundancy architecture to enhance system reliability. In the monitoring of steam turbines in power plants, it is used for the main tripping circuit and emergency tripping system, and cooperates with DCS to realize dual redundancy of remote and local hard-wired protection. It is also suitable for the control of extraction valve solenoid valves in cogeneration systems and the load distribution of power generation and heating. At the same time, it drives solenoid valves such as electrical locking and oil reset through four auxiliary control outputs, and supports maintenance functions such as electrical overspeed trip tests. Its ordinary PCB coating makes it more suitable for indoor clean industrial environments. If installed in a sealed control cabinet, it can also be used in heavy industrial scenarios such as metallurgy and cement. The core value lies in building a safety protection logic closed loop for steam turbines and related power systems, and realizing the rapid response from signal acquisition to execution action through the electrical isolation and contact switching of relays to ensure the safe operation of industrial equipment.
